CASTLEDOCKRELL NS
We are very proud of our Active Flag in Castledockrell National School and every year we celebrate Active Week in June. This year the sun shone for the week so we did our ‘Wake Up, Shake Up’ every morning on the court. We also did some Kickboxing and Kung Fu lessons, had a teddy bears picnic, did active homework for the week and celebrated sports day on Thursday, June 21. Activities included relay races, water races, Zumba classes, an obstacle course, a bouncy castle, space hopper races, spud and spoon, sack races, three legged races, the high jump, uni-hockey matches and much, much more. We even had a parent’s race. It was a ‘Sport for all’ day and the focus was on being a team player and having fun.
